We have a Ricoh c7100 with the sr5060 booklet finisher. This finisher has all of a sudden refused to run letter size sheet or anything under 12x18. It will run out one sample, but after that it will constantly jam in the same spot (where the side guides jog it together before sending to staple and fold. Will run 12x18 sheets all day long, but under 12" wide we get jammed.
I have check over all feed routes to see if there was a paper chunk stuck or something and have come up short. Also cleaned thoroughly all feed wheels.
Would you have any recommendations on where to turn next? We are in the middle of two long runnign saddle-stitch booklets and have started them on 12x18 and cutting the waste, but it's a lot of unneeded waste so I need to run it to size. Any advice is greatly appreciated.
